The wads you see are likely in the UPDATE partition. The update BTW is system 3.4...

The channel is in the "INSTALLER" partition (It's Partition #2 on the disc in WiiScrubber, #1 is UPDATE, #3 is the actual game). The filename is "HealthNANDPackUp.wad"
